As a first-time director, Weatherly says his biggest challenge came as an actor. “By the end of this episode, I felt DiNozzo had significantly altered,” he says. “He awakens from a four-year sleep. I was glad to see him back! In this episode and the next, he’s in a Sean Connery place — pretty deadly serious with a twinkle in his eye.”
That glint may be provided by Brothers & Sisters vet Sarah Jane Morris, who debuts as a new NCIS agent — and a potential love interest for Tony. Can the buffoon really transform into Bond? “As the director, I had certain powers,” he boasts, “and I hope the audience is pleased.” Well played, Mr. Weatherly.
